Buying Guide for the Best Powerful Cordless Vacuum

Choosing the right powerful cordless vacuum can make a significant difference in maintaining a clean and healthy home. Cordless vacuums offer the convenience of being lightweight and easy to maneuver without the hassle of cords. However, with so many options available, it's important to understand the key specifications that will help you find the best fit for your needs. Here are the main specs to consider when selecting a powerful cordless vacuum.
Battery LifeBattery life refers to how long the vacuum can operate on a single charge. This is important because it determines how much cleaning you can do before needing to recharge. Battery life can range from 15 minutes to over an hour. If you have a larger home or plan to use the vacuum for extended periods, look for models with longer battery life. For smaller spaces or quick clean-ups, a shorter battery life may suffice.
Suction PowerSuction power indicates the vacuum's ability to pick up dirt and debris. This is crucial for ensuring effective cleaning, especially on carpets and rugs. Suction power is often measured in air watts (AW) or pascals (Pa). Higher values mean stronger suction. If you have pets, thick carpets, or a lot of debris, opt for a vacuum with higher suction power. For hard floors and lighter cleaning tasks, moderate suction power should be adequate.
Dustbin CapacityDustbin capacity refers to the amount of dirt and debris the vacuum can hold before needing to be emptied. This is important for convenience and efficiency. Capacities can range from 0.3 liters to over 1 liter. If you have a larger home or prefer less frequent emptying, choose a vacuum with a larger dustbin. For smaller homes or if you don't mind emptying the bin more often, a smaller capacity will do.
WeightWeight is the overall heaviness of the vacuum. This is important for ease of use and maneuverability. Cordless vacuums typically weigh between 2 to 7 pounds. If you need to carry the vacuum up and down stairs or use it for extended periods, a lighter model will be more comfortable. For quick clean-ups or if weight is not a major concern, a heavier model may be acceptable.
Attachments and AccessoriesAttachments and accessories include additional tools that come with the vacuum, such as crevice tools, dusting brushes, and motorized pet tools. These are important for versatility and specialized cleaning tasks. If you have pets, look for models with pet-specific tools. For cleaning tight spaces or delicate surfaces, ensure the vacuum comes with the appropriate attachments. Consider your specific cleaning needs to determine which accessories are essential for you.
Filtration SystemThe filtration system refers to how the vacuum filters out dust and allergens from the air. This is important for maintaining indoor air quality, especially for allergy sufferers. High-efficiency particulate air (HEPA) filters are the gold standard, capturing 99.97% of particles. If you have allergies or asthma, choose a vacuum with a HEPA filter. For general cleaning, a standard filtration system may be sufficient.
Charging TimeCharging time is the duration it takes to fully recharge the vacuum's battery. This is important for minimizing downtime between cleaning sessions. Charging times can range from 2 to 5 hours. If you need to use the vacuum frequently, look for models with shorter charging times. For occasional use, longer charging times may not be an issue.
